I was not expecting the phone call I received yesterday, "Hey bud, your Jeep just rolled off the truck."
32 days from order to delivery. Has anyone heard of a timeline this short yet? I will consider myself lucky.
Order Placed: May 10, 2018 for a 2018 JLU Rubicon, 3.6 L (options were LED lights, steel bumpers, Infotainment, Hardtop, automatic, all weather mats, HD electrical/Tow, cold weather group)
May 31: Dealer notified of entering "D1" status
June 6: Build sheet found.
June 8: Window sticker found.
June 9 (Saturday): Dealer notified me of "KLZD"? Status which I was told by the dealer to be "Transit Delay" but that apparently means "See you Monday" in Georgia.
June 11: Jeep arrived at dealer in Marietta, GA
We were not expecting to drive our Jeep home yesterday so needless to say, we are blessed and really enjoying this.
